BlazarVisionMedia is founded on executing a vision that is blazar-like in delivery. We engage in real discussions that span from everyday practicalities to philosophical intangibles, all aiming at uncovering the deep insights that lie within every narrative. We keep it 1000, we say what we think in the moment and are not fixed to one ideology. The goal is to sharpen our ability to articulate our ever changing, complex thoughts, into any discussion.   • From “Back Home” to Bold Voice: Unlearning the Silence on Palestine
    Oct 28 2025

    What happens when a Palestinian-American discovers her homeland doesn't exist in her teacher's flag book? This raw, unfiltered conversation exposes the hidden history they don't teach in schools.Join Anthony as he sits down with Samantha, a Palestinian-American scholar with over two decades of expertise in Middle Eastern politics and firsthand experience living in Palestine. From discovering her erased identity in Catholic school to navigating armed checkpoints where families sleep in cars for hours, Samantha reveals the shocking reality of daily life under occupation.Uncover the untold story of the 1948 ethnic cleansing, the British betrayal that promised the same land to two peoples, and how 8,000 Israeli settlers relocated from Gaza to the West Bank created the fragmented map we see today. Learn why a 20-minute drive takes 90 minutes through dangerous mountain passes, and how supremacy—not religion—lies at the heart of this conflict.This isn't propaganda. It's history, DNA evidence, personal experience, and a call for equality. Discover why speaking about Palestine risks censorship, how Canaanite ancestry connects Palestinians to ancient biblical peoples, and why coexistence—not separation—offers the only path to peace.WARNING: This conversation challenges mainstream narratives. This is aiming to give perspective from the source.Note from Anthony: As difficult as it is to speak about something like this,I wanted to make sure that the message, even how dim it currently is, is as positive as it can aiming towards REAL peace and we do that through conversation and learning about both sides of the coin.
